  • November 26, 2020 ACE Lab Participated in the FiFE´20 Digital Forensics Fair, Spain

    ACE Lab has participated in the online FiFE´20 Digital Forensics Fair – one of the most popular gatherings of government agencies and private companies in Spain. This time, we have shared our knowledge in recovering evidence from SSDs based on the PCIe interface and WD SMR drives with TRIM. These topics are significant nowadays because, previously, there were no solutions to the issues related to such drives.

    Today, you can work with different PCIe SSDs thanks to the PC-3000 Portable III Systems and bypass the TRIM command on modern WD SMR HDDs in some cases! To learn more, please follow the link below.

  • October 16, 2020 The PC-3000 Portable III Now Supports the Silicon Motion SM2258XT SSDs!

    ACE lab developers have done a great job by researching Silicon Motion SM2258XT SSDs and optimizing the algorithms to make the most efficient and stable Utility for this type of the drives. As such, you can now raise your data recovery success rate by dealing with Silicon Power Slim S55, KingDian S200, WD Green, Apacer AS350 Panther, Patriot P200, Smartbuy Jolt, RevuAhn 885, Crucial BX500, and other SM2258XT SSDs.

    The support appears with the beta version of the PC-3000 SSD Extended software ver. 2.9.3 available for the PC-3000 Portable III users. To get the beta version of the software, please contact our Technical Support Department.

  • October 02, 2020 The PCIe AHCI SSDs: Now Supported by the PC-3000 Portable III

    By popular demand, we have added the PCIe AHCI SSDs to the Support List with the BETA ver. 6.8.2 of the PC-3000 Portable III software. To deal with this type of storage media, you additionally need the new PCIe NVMe/AHCI Adapter for Apple Macbook SSD and PCIe x16 SSD Adapter.

    This solution has significantly increased the number of supported PCIe SSDs, especially Apple Macbook SSDs. If previously we only had 2017-2019 devices in the Supported List, now the manufacture dates of supported Apple Macbook SSDs start from 2013! Please follow the link below to learn more about it.
